Throughout 2025, George House Trust is proud to present a series of events celebrating the rich history of HIV activism in Greater Manchester.

Our next event, Women and HIV: Personal Stories of Activism, will bring together inspiring women who have been at the forefront of positive change in the field of HIV in Greater Manchester. 

Join us for an uplifting evening that will highlight stories from the archive while addressing current issues affecting women and HIV today.

The event will take place at SISTER (Renold Building, 81 Sackville St, Manchester M1 3NJ) and will begin at 6pm.

Complimentary food and drinks will be provided.
